Frequently asked questions about hostels in Milan

  • What affordable attractions should backpackers visit in Milan?

    Milan has plenty of free or cheap attractions for budget travellers! You can stroll through the beautiful Parco Sempione, explore the stunning Duomo, and visit the Navigli canals for a vibrant atmosphere. For art lovers, the Pinacoteca di Brera is a must-see, with its impressive collection of Italian paintings.

  • What nightlife options are popular among hostel guests in Milan?

    Hostel guests often head to the Navigli area for its lively bars and clubs. The area around the Darsena, a canal basin, has a lot of bars and restaurants that are popular with travellers. For a more alternative vibe, try the Isola district, known for its independent bars and clubs.

  • What’s the best budget-friendly way to reach Milan?

    Flying into Milan's Malpensa Airport (MXP) is usually the most affordable option. The airport is well-connected to the city centre by train, bus, or shuttle. You can also take a low-cost flight to Bergamo Airport (BGY) and then take a bus or train to Milan.

  • What's the best time of the year to visit Milan?

    The best time to visit Milan is in spring (April to May) or autumn (September to October) when the weather is mild and the city is less crowded. Summer can be hot and humid, and winter can be cold and wet.

  • Where in Milan can you find the best areas to stay in a hostel?

    The best areas to stay in a hostel are near the main attractions, like the Duomo, the Galleria Vittorio Emanuele II, and the Navigli canals. The areas around the Porta Venezia and Porta Romana train stations are also good options, as they are well-connected to the rest of the city.
